Braille Displays In Durga Puja Pandal In bengal, Committees Helping Visually Impaired To Enjoy Festival

According to the most recent updates of Mirror Now, this year's Durga Puja in West Bengal will be special for everyone. After two years, people will celebrate the festival. Different pandals are making creative pandals. The big stage is set for Durga Pooja. In order to make Durga Puja for everyone, three community puja committees in the city are installing Braille display boards this year to help the visually impaired pandal hoppers feel and enjoy the grandeur of the festival without depending on volunteers to explain it to them. The facility will enable them to learn in detail about the decor and the idol by touching the surface of the Braille display board.#DurgaPuja #WestBengalDurgaPuja #MamataBanerjee
